Output 44f5220646ef3a72ac4b1da4b025d4dc15914c2ce4e4ac7dbb0dcc5d00cf97fe:11

value
511307916
script pubkey
OP_0 OP_PUSHBYTES_20 e93d4612bd443a675f815e8211b5287c11454442
address
bc1qay75vy4agsaxwhupt6pprdfg0sg523zzhl59nm
transaction
44f5220646ef3a72ac4b1da4b025d4dc15914c2ce4e4ac7dbb0dcc5d00cf97fe
spent
true